Abstract
In this paper we formulate OFDM signals based on explicit pulse shaping filtering. A rectangular pulse in time domain for shaping filtering is most often used, but it has SNR loss compared to a shaping filter with a brick-wall frequency domain filter since in practice both require guard time or guard band. Our formulation of OFDM signal based purely on shaping filter may provide a common platform, and both can be implemented efficiently using DFT and commutating polyphase filters.
